  1. Joseph James DeAngelo Jr. (born November 8, 1945) is an American former police officer, serial killer, serial rapist, burglar, peeping tom, and former mechanic who committed at least 13 murders, 51 rapes, and 120 burglaries across California between 1974 and 1986.
